Problem with Ford 4.2 lts. Posted by manual-mecanica
Greetings friends, I have a problem with a Ford 150 4.2 Lts V-6 truck, this vehicle has the problem that it does not stand to accelerate, as if it lacked pressure to the gasoline pump but this one is (40-45 pounds of pressure), it does not unbrings or endures when walking as if it were upholstered the tasting but it does not bring, I made tuning, lave laborators in laboratory and work very well, they work in the laboratory. Pulsations in the injectors work very well, occupy scanner and did not throw any fault code and do not turn on the light of Check Engine when it makes the failure, this vehicle when stopping and when accelerating hurriedly it reaches 3000 rpm since it does not stand to unbhal thank you...

Manual-Mecanica response on the Re: problem with Ford 4.2 lts.
Hello,

you could check the MAF sensor signal, because the motor load sensor, another thing would be the TPS sensor, if it is out of range when you accelerate it will not indicate to the ECU that is the fully open acceleration butterfly but partially.

Manual-Mecanica response on the Re: problem with Ford 4.2 lts.
Greetings friends, the problem with this vehicle was that the wedge that goes in the crankshaft suffered wear and the crankshaft pulley was run from time and the cigueñal symptor lost the progress, I disarmed the distribution to revive the chain and there I realized the problem, I already changed the wedge and the pulley and the problem disappeared, thanks to those who supported me with the problem.
